Moa Bones performing the Wolf song Moa Bones  (aka Dimitris Aronis) is a singer-songwriter and multi-instrumentalist experimenting with folk-pop and art-punk music. He performed in situ “The Wolf Song” in Athens’ railway for the street music series “Stray Songs” produced by Shoot The Band team.
